In a future where human augmentation is standard, Major Mira Killian (Scarlett Johansson) is a "full-body" cyborg supersoldier working for Section 9. While hunting a cyber-terrorist named Kuze, she begins to recover fragmented memories of a past she was told didn't exist.

The film received mixed reviews from critics, with some praising its visuals and action sequences, while others criticized its storyline and character development. The film holds a 43% approval rating on Rotten Tomatoes, with an average rating of 5.6/10.

It is impossible to discuss the 2017 Ghost in the Shell without addressing the controversies surrounding its production, specifically the casting of Scarlett Johansson, which drew significant criticism regarding "whitewashing" and the erasure of Asian representation. For many, these issues overshadowed the film's visual achievements, making the 1995 animated film, or other adaptations, "better" in terms of cultural authenticity. Conclusion: Is it "Better"?
Saying the 2017 Ghost in the Shell is "better" depends entirely on what a viewer wants from a movie. If you are looking for groundbreaking philosophical philosophy, the 1995 anime remains unmatched. However, if you are searching for an entertaining, visually spectacular sci-fi action movie with clear stakes and an accessible plot, the 2017 Hollywood adaptation stands on its own merits as a highly enjoyable film.
